

Erica Wallace, DVM
Dr. Wallace is originally from Forrest City, Arkansas. She received her Doctor of Veterinary Medicine degree in 2006 from Louisiana State University School of Veterinary Medicine. After receiving her DVM, Dr. Wallace completed a one-year equine medicine and surgery internship at Chaparral Animal Hospital in Phoenix, Arizona. Oklahoma has been her home ever since. Dr. Wallace has practiced both equine and small animal medicine in the Tulsa area since 2007.
Dr. Wallace has special interests in surgery and dentistry. Dr. Wallace is a member of the American Veterinary Medical Association, American Association of Equine Practitioners, and Oklahoma Veterinary Medical Association. She is currently licensed to practice medicine in Arkansas and Oklahoma.
